Charger Track Teams Face Stiff Competition at Audubon; Boys Finish Fourth, Girls Sixth


Boys' track teams from the Western Iowa Conference claimed the top three spots at the Wheeler Relays held in Audubon yesterday, while the Chargers finished fourth in the twelve team meet. Underwood, Treynor, and IKM-Manning all finished ahead of the local cindermen in the highly competitive meet.

Charger Noah Nelson continued his mastery in the long distance events, as he won both the 1600 and 3200 meter runs, with times of 4:43.80 and 9:59.82 respectively. Each of Nelson's times were less than one second off his season bests. Nelson's two golds were the only first place finishes by the Charger team. Senior sprinter Dylan Soper won two silvers when he finished second in both the 100 and 200 meter dashes with times of 11.72 and 24.30.

The Charger girls found the competition equally as keen, finishing with its lowest point total of the season at 48 which placed ACG in sixth place among the ten girls' teams at the meet. Panorama continued its season long dominance, as it captured the title with 152 points.

Kate Crawford took home the only gold for the Chargers, as she won the 800 meters in a time of 2:29.82. Crawford's time marks the first time she has gone under 2:30 and gives her the best time run by WCAC competitors this spring.

The girls picked up two second place finishes, as Madison McDermott threw the discus 108'8" and the 3200 relay made up of Audrey Stowe, Lauryn Embleton, Rylee Sloss, and Crawford ran the oval in 10:33.28.

The teams will have an opportunity to compete at home tomorrow (Thursday), when they host seven other schools in a co-ed meet beginning at 5 PM.
